在Svelte应用中实现动态路由和懒加载页面的最佳策略是什么

发布时间:2024-06-15 11:43:57 作者:小樊
来源:亿速云 阅读:89

在Svelte应用中实现动态路由和懒加载页面的最佳策略是使用SvelteKit,它是Svelte官方推出的工具,提供了路由管理和页面懒加载的功能。通过SvelteKit的路由配置文件,可以轻松定义动态路由,并在需要时按需加载页面组件,从而实现懒加载的效果。

在SvelteKit中,可以使用load函数来动态加载页面组件,例如:

// routes/index.svelte
<script>
  import { load } from '@sveltejs/kit';
  const dynamicComponent = load(() => import('./DynamicComponent.svelte'));
</script>

{#if dynamicComponent}
  <svelte:component this={dynamicComponent} />
{/if}

通过以上代码,可以在需要时动态加载DynamicComponent.svelte组件,并在页面中渲染出来。这样就实现了懒加载的效果,只有在页面需要时才会加载对应的组件。

总的来说,使用SvelteKit的路由配置和load函数,可以很方便地实现动态路由和懒加载页面的最佳策略。

推荐阅读:
  1. 人们还没有转向Svelte的原因是什么
  2. Svelte和React的区别是什么

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

svelte

上一篇:如何在Svelte项目中实现和管理多主题切换

下一篇:如何在SvelteKit项目中结合使用服务端渲染和静态站点生成

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》